Four Oaks, NC:   Mrs. Mavis Pearl McGee Johnson, age 84, of Elevation Road died Monday, May 6, 2024 at her residence surrounded by her loving family. Funeral services will be 11:00AM Thursday, May 9, 2024 at Rose & Graham Funeral Chapel in Benson.  Officiating will be Elder Tony Parker.  Entombment will follow in Roselawn Cemetery, Benson.                     

Mrs. Johnson was born August 25, 1939 in Johnston County to the late Alton and Floy Velma McGee. She was preceded in death by her husband, Linwood Gray Johnson; sisters and brothers, Alice Cox, Eugene McGee, Robert McGee, Joyce Southerland, Merle Hodges, Brenda Taylor, James McGee, and Derle McGee. Mrs. Johnson retired from First Citizen Bank in Raleigh after 30 years in customer service. She was a member of Sweet Adelines and Southern Rain Band along with her siblings, Robert and Ken, and nephew, David Penny. Mrs. Johnson was a member of Four Oaks Primitive Baptist Church where she also enjoyed singing hymns with her church family. She loved to cook, entertain, never met a stranger, and had a beautiful contagious smile. 

Surviving are her daughter, Dawn Medeiros of Charlottesville, VA; son and daughter-in-law, Phillip Lynn & Pauline Johnson of Four Oaks; grandchildren, Spencer Missbach, Nicholas Johnson, and Coleton Missbach; brother, Ken McGee and wife, Debbie; and numerous nieces and nephews.
